Ticket to Super Bowl XXII

National Museum of African American History and Culture

Addthis Share Tools

    • Print

Object Details

Created by
National Football League, American, founded 1920
Subject of
Doug Williams, born 1955
Washington Redskins, American, founded 1932
Denver Broncos, American, founded 1960
Caption
Washington quarterback Doug Williams was selected as the Most Valuable Player of the game, and he was the first African American quarterback to win the Super Bowl. Washington won the game 42-10.
Description
A ticket to Super Bowl XXII between Washington and Denver played on January 31st, 1988. The ticket is for Section 40, Row 4, Seat 3 on the Press Level and has a face price of $100.00. The ticket is intact. The front has an image of a white sculptural archway with the Lombardi Trophy underneath it. In the background is an illustrated view of San Diego. The back has a map of the stadium and surrounding roads. The ticket is housed in a plastic case with a label.
